WebPterois noun Pter· ois ˈterəwə̇s, -eˌrȯis : a genus of small brilliantly colored scorpion fishes including the lionfishes Word History Etymology New Latin, probably from Greek pteroeis feathered, winged, from pteron feather, wing Love words?
